“Super happy with my upgrade from Pi 4. I had to reinstall OS from scratch, using Home Assistant package, but the migration was easy - just did a backup, downloaded it and restored from it on the new system. Really nice kit, with heatsink and fan and purpose-made box. I like having an official PSU as there are so many USB "chargers" around now, and they are all different.”

“Excellent build quality and easy to put together. I would recommend adding an instruction or label on the diagram to show which parts of the board the heat-sink should be added to; unless you already had knowledge about motherboards it may be difficult to identify. At this moment the only other critique I have would be that the case doesnt hold strongly therfore it wouldve been ideal if screws we provided to hold the case togther better. The usb ports were stiff to put in since they had not been used so more force was required and as the case was not strongly attached together it was fiddly.”
